A Guide to Integrating Document Management Systems with HR Tools
How to integrate DMS and HR tools: APIs, middleware, mobile capture, metadata, security, and step-by-step rollouts for small businesses.
A Guide to Integrating Document Management Systems with HR Tools
Integrating document management systems (DMS) with HR tools is one of the highest-leverage improvements a small business can make. The result: faster onboarding, reliable audit trails, fewer lost contracts, and measurable time savings for HR and operations teams. This guide walks through practical integration techniques inspired by modern HR-focused startups — from APIs and middleware patterns to mobile capture, metadata strategy, and compliance checkpoints.
Why integrate DMS and HR tools?
Reduce manual work and human error
HR departments handle repetitive document tasks: offer letters, I-9s, benefits forms, NDAs, and performance records. Manually saving and naming documents causes inconsistency and retrieval friction. By integrating DMS with HR systems you eliminate duplicate data entry, reduce filing mistakes, and ensure a single source of truth for employee documents.
Improve security and auditability
Integration enables policies to be enforced at the point of capture: retention rules, access controls, and full audit logs. That reduces compliance risk and simplifies audits. For a deeper look at privacy trade-offs and detection technologies that affect compliance programs, see Age Detection Technologies: What They Mean for Privacy.
Enable automation across HR workflows
Most HR workflows are state-based (candidate -> hire -> active -> offboard). Integrations let documents move with the state, triggering tasks like e-signature, archival, or access revocation. For examples of how AI and automation transform workflows, read From Messaging Gaps to Conversion: How AI Tools Can Transform.
Common HR documents and the integration needs they create
Pre-hire and hiring documents
Resumes, application forms, background checks, and interview notes need secure, limited-lifetime storage. Integrations should enforce role-based access and automatic purging where legally required. This matters for startups and teams scaling fast — a lesson echoed in marketplaces studying market shifts: Decoding Market Trends.
Onboarding and employment records
Offer letters, employment agreements, tax forms, and benefits enrollment need both a DMS and an HRIS handshake. Common patterns include attaching signed PDFs to employee records and recording a timestamped event in the HR system.
Ongoing HR files and offboarding
Performance reviews, disciplinary records, and exit paperwork require carefully managed retention schedules and restricted access. Integrations that automate archival on termination reduce legal exposure and administrative load.
Integration architectures: patterns and when to use them
Direct API integration (HR tool <-> DMS)
Direct API connections are ideal when both systems expose robust, documented APIs. This pattern minimizes moving parts and latency. It requires engineering resources to map fields and handle authentication. Developers should understand API constraints like rate limits — practical knowledge you can get from resources such as Understanding Rate-Limiting Techniques.
Middleware and iPaaS (integration platform as a service)
iPaaS solutions (Zapier, Make, Workato, or custom middleware) are best when you need business-user-friendly automation, connectors for many apps, and message transformation. They are particularly useful for small teams without dedicated backend engineering resources.
Event-driven or webhook-forwarded architectures
Use event-driven models when document events (upload, sign, classify) must trigger downstream processes. Webhooks paired with message queues make this resilient and scalable. Startups often evolve to event-driven models as volume increases — a pattern described in broader tech shifts like The Asian Tech Surge.
Step-by-step plan to implement an integration
1) Map the workflows and owner responsibilities
Begin by documenting concrete workflows: who uploads offer letters, who approves benefits, who archives separation agreements. Define owners for each touchpoint and the desired automated outcome. Use a simple RACI model to assign responsibilities.
2) Inventory documents, metadata, and retention rules
List document types, the metadata fields they need (employee ID, department, status, hire date), and retention policies. Poor metadata is the most common cause of failed retrieval. When thinking about long-term strategy, consider insights from future-proofing discussions: Future-Proofing Trends.
3) Prototype with a minimal integration
Create a narrow prototype: e.g., new-hire packet upload -> DMS folder -> HRIS attachment + webhook for audit log. Validate with real users before scaling. This iterative approach mirrors startup product best practices and reduces rework.
Security, access control, and compliance
Authentication and least privilege
Always adopt OAuth2 or equivalent token-based auth for API integrations. Service accounts should have the minimal scopes needed. Monitor for stale credentials and use rotating secrets when possible.
Encryption and data residency
Encrypt documents at rest and in transit. If your HR team is international, pay attention to data residency and regional laws — some HR startups build geo-aware storage to stay compliant.
Retention, legal holds, and audit trails
Integrations should support automated retention rules and legal holds. Maintain immutable audit logs that record who accessed or modified documents. If you face service discontinuation risk, plan migration ahead as discussed in Challenges of Discontinued Services.
Metadata strategy: design for findability
Unique identifiers and canonical keys
Every employee and document should have canonical identifiers (employee ID, document UUID). Avoid filename-based dependencies. Canonical keys make joins between the HR database and DMS reliable.
Controlled vocabularies and taxonomies
Define a small set of controlled values for document types and departments. A small taxonomy reduces ambiguity and improves search relevancy. Think like a librarian: consistent tagging beats clever filenames.
Search and faceted navigation
Expose key metadata to search indexes so HR staff can filter by hire date, manager, or document type. Modern DMS solutions and search engines support faceted search; enable it for the top 5-10 filters used day-to-day.
Automation examples and scripts
Auto-attach signed offer letters to HRIS
Pattern: When a document is signed in an e-sign provider, a webhook posts the signed PDF to the DMS, then an API call attaches the URL to the employee record in the HRIS and sets status to "Onboarded." This eliminates manual downloads and uploads and creates a timestamped record.
Auto-archive terminated employee files
Pattern: Termination event triggers a workflow: move active documents to a restricted archive folder, apply retention policy, and revoke shared links. This reduces the risk of lingering access after an employee leaves.
Auto-classify incoming documents with ML
Use lightweight classification models to detect document types (resume, W-4, contract) at ingest. Classification can set metadata automatically and route documents into the correct HR workflow. For automation inspiration, see how AI tools increase productivity in adjacent domains: Maximizing Productivity: AI Tools.
Mobile capture, scanning, and field use
Optimizing scanning on low-memory devices
Many HR teams rely on mobile capture. Design mobile clients for variable device memory and connectivity. Best practices for handling resource-constrained devices are discussed in How to Adapt to RAM Cuts in Handheld Devices.
Siri, voice, and quick-capture integrations
Small teams can boost adoption with shortcuts: voice notes, Siri shortcuts, and direct imports from email. Explore mobile integration ideas such as leveraging Siri with notes: Leveraging Siri's New Capabilities.
Edge OCR and privacy considerations
Perform OCR on-device when possible to reduce transmission of sensitive data. If using cloud OCR, apply encryption and consent flows to remain compliant with privacy rules.
Selection criteria: choosing the right vendors and tools
APIs, SDKs, and developer experience
Evaluate API completeness, documentation quality, and SDK availability. Developer experience is a practical metric; look for sample code, rate limits, and sandbox environments. Understanding rate-limiting and backoff strategies is essential for robust integrations: see Understanding Rate-Limiting Techniques.
Integration support and ecosystem
Vendor marketplaces and existing HR connectors reduce time-to-deploy. If you're building custom connectors, vendor responsiveness matters. Consider larger technology trends and regional developer ecosystems described in The Asian Tech Surge.
Total cost of ownership and switching costs
Compare subscription cost, integration engineering hours, storage fees, and expected team efficiency gains. Think ahead to potential vendor discontinuation — plan exports and backups as discussed in Challenges of Discontinued Services.
Troubleshooting, scaling, and operations
Monitoring and observability
Instrument integrations with metrics and alerts: failed uploads, webhook retries, auth errors, and unusual access patterns. Observability prevents small issues from becoming operational outages.
Handling rate limits and retries
Implement exponential backoff and idempotency keys for uploads. Idempotency prevents duplicate documents when retries occur. Again, techniques for rate control and retry design are well-covered in engineering resources such as Understanding Rate-Limiting Techniques.
Change management and adoption
Integration success is 50% technical and 50% people. Provide clear documentation, short training sessions, and a "sandbox" area for HR to test workflows. Cultural acceptance often hinges on small wins: faster onboarding times or fewer misplaced documents. Lessons on compromise and stakeholder buy-in can be drawn from broader change narratives like The Art of Compromise.
Comparison: Integration approaches at a glance
Choose the pattern that fits your team size, technical capacity, and volume. The table below compares common approaches across several dimensions.
| Approach | Best for | Engineering effort | Flexibility | Time to value |
|---|---|---|---|---|
| Direct API | Teams with engineers and high volume | High | High | Medium |
| iPaaS / Connectors | Small teams needing quick automations | Low | Medium | Fast |
| Webhook + Middleware | Event-driven workflows and integrations | Medium | High | Medium |
| RPA (UI automation) | Legacy systems without APIs | Medium | Low | Medium |
| Hybrid (API + Human In the Loop) | Compliance-heavy workflows requiring approvals | Medium | High | Medium |
Pro Tip: Start with the smallest automation that saves at least 15 minutes per week for a person. Early wins build momentum and make it easier to secure engineering time for larger integrations.
Case study inspirations and cross-industry lessons
Startups optimizing hiring workflows
HR-focused startups often prioritize fast, secure signing and single-click onboarding. They build microservices that push signed offers to long-term storage and update the HRIS in one atomic transaction. For risks around AI in hiring and what to watch for, read lessons from early regulators: Navigating AI Risks in Hiring.
Lessons from logistics and coding strategies
Complex industries like freight auditing teach resilient coding strategies: strong idempotency, canonical identifiers, and robust error handling. These patterns apply directly to document integrations — see Freight Audit Evolution for engineering analogies.
Community and nonprofit approaches
Nonprofits often do more with less and adopt pragmatic storage and access models that balance transparency and privacy. If you work with community-oriented teams, consider their budgeting models and impact-centered priorities highlighted in Community Impact.
Costs, ROI, and business case
Estimate time savings and headcount impact
Quantify time saved per workflow (minutes) and multiply by frequency and number of users. Translate saved hours into FTE (full-time equivalent) months and compare to integration cost. Use conservative estimates for adoption ramp.
Hard and soft benefits
Hard benefits: reduced file storage costs, fewer compliance fines, fewer outsourced indexing services. Soft benefits: improved employee experience and reduced time-to-productivity for new hires. Economic trends that influence small businesses' budgets are discussed in Understanding Economic Impacts.
Vendor negotiation and switching considerations
Negotiate data export terms and clear SLAs. Consider the effort to switch providers; factors like proprietary metadata schemes or large binary stores increase migration costs. Example consumer choices show how switching decisions need clear criteria: Five Must-Consider Factors Before Switching.
Operational maturity: growing from prototype to platform
Standardize connectors and folder structures
Create templates for folders, metadata sets, and retention policies so new integrations follow an established pattern. This reduces bespoke work and makes future audits straightforward.
Governance and periodic audits
Set quarterly checks for policy compliance, access reviews, and storage growth. Governance reduces technical debt and helps you prioritize upgrades.
Innovation and continuous improvement
Encourage feedback loops between HR, IT, and legal. Small experiments — A/B testing capture forms or classification models — identify high-impact improvements. Techniques from other domains, like content optimization or community engagement, can inspire adoption strategies: Mastering Reddit: SEO Strategies for Engagement and Maximizing Productivity show practical experimentation approaches.
Frequently Asked Questions
1) What is the easiest integration to start with?
Start with a single webhook that attaches signed offer letters to an employee record. It delivers high value and is low risk.
2) How do I ensure privacy when using cloud OCR?
Use encryption in transit, data minimization, and contractual data processing agreements with your OCR provider. Consider on-device OCR where feasible.
3) How can small HR teams manage without engineers?
Use iPaaS tools and pre-built connectors. Focus on automations that remove repetitive tasks and lean on vendor support.
4) What if my HRIS has poor API support?
Consider middleware that emulates user actions (RPA) or evaluate swapping to an HRIS with stronger integration capabilities when budget allows.
5) How do I plan for vendor discontinuation?
Export data periodically, maintain canonical metadata, and avoid lock-in to proprietary formats. Planning prevents urgent migrations; see Challenges of Discontinued Services for guidance.
Final checklist before you launch
- Document workflows and owners for each automated touchpoint.
- Define metadata, retention rules, and access policies clearly.
- Build a narrow prototype and validate with HR users.
- Ensure authentication, encryption, and audit logging are in place.
- Plan monitoring, rate-limit handling, and error recovery.
- Schedule training and collect early feedback for quick iteration.
Integrating your DMS with HR tools is a strategic investment that pays back through time savings, reduced risk, and improved employee experience. Use the patterns in this guide to plan a pragmatic rollout, starting small and scaling as users adopt the new flows. Look to adjacent industries and engineering practices — from rate limiting to coding strategies — for inspiration and robustness: Freight Audit Evolution, Rate-Limiting Techniques, and Navigating AI Risks in Hiring are useful reads.
Related Reading
- The Perfect Cozy Night In - Light reading on curating comfort items for winter evenings.
- Weathering the Heat - A guide to fabrics for active summer use.
- Freelancing in the Age of Algorithms - Perspectives on the changing freelance market.
- Fostering Community - Building local shared spaces and community impact.
- Betting Strategies for Newbies - Beginner betting strategies and risk notes.
Related Topics
Avery Morgan
Senior Editor & Integration Strategist
Senior editor and content strategist. Writing about technology, design, and the future of digital media. Follow along for deep dives into the industry's moving parts.
Up Next
More stories handpicked for you
How Specialty Chemical Teams Can Build a Faster Document Trail for M&A, Supply Chain, and Regulatory Reviews
How Specialty Chemical Teams Can Turn Market Research Reports Into Faster Approvals and Cleaner Signing Workflows
Choosing the Right Tools: A Comprehensive Guide to Document Workflow Systems
Version Control for Document Workflows: Preserve, Audit, and Roll Back Scan & Signing Processes
Build a Reusable Scan-to-Sign Workflow with n8n Templates
From Our Network
Trending stories across our publication group